Introduction
A man has been critically injured after a horrific workplace accident in Ipswich, south of Brisbane, involving a scissor lift.
Key Points
- A man in his 60s sustained life-threatening injuries to his abdomen, chest, and head.
- The incident occurred outside a business on Torch St in Ipswich, near Ipswich Girls’ Grammar School.
- The man was rushed to Princess Alexandra Hospital in critical condition.
- WorkSafe Queensland is investigating the incident.
Details of the Ipswich Worksite Incident
Paramedics were called to the scene around 7:10 am on Thursday. They found the man trapped between a scissor lift and a fence outside a business premises. He was treated at the scene for life-threatening injuries before being transported to Princess Alexandra Hospital.
About Scissor Lifts
A scissor lift is a mobile work platform with crisscrossing beams that allow it to be raised and lowered. These lifts are commonly used in construction, maintenance, and other industries where workers need to access elevated areas.
